Output ba455a5257eb6a0a7e4bf99528619b53f95a62d1b366364ab0aa94d5b47dea0e:29

value
71792
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0ff1c19e37ecaf919c31c5dd11d7afb8b95245b9 OP_EQUAL
address
339KfwkgfmeanxHECbxCmuYzytzsUKkeF7
transaction
ba455a5257eb6a0a7e4bf99528619b53f95a62d1b366364ab0aa94d5b47dea0e
confirmations
43995
spent
true